I voted for Germany because of the structure of their state, since that is the government, but Denmark and Sweden have better policies. The best.

Basic problems with the US:
1. Undemocratic Senate
2. First past the post, single member districts create two party system
3. Electoral college
4. Nobody cares about the constitution, even while we fetishize the founders.
